Bourjois Volume Glamour Max Holidays Mascara

 
Bourjois Volume Glamour Max Holidays Mascara - £5.99
 
I remember receiving this mascara in a Bourjois gift box thing at Christmas time and I was going to blog about it in January, but with my rotation of mascaras I just never got round to it and now that i've finally used up the couple that I was working on i've been able to start using this one and I can finally give my opinion on it.
 
Firstly, how cute and small is this tube? This would definitely be perfect for travel, and when researching this mascara you can actually still buy this mascara in this size tube if you wish to. Or you can buy the full size for £9.99.
 
 
First of all, look at the size of the brush of this mascara! It's pretty big, and if you don't like the bigger brushes on mascaras then you won't be a fan of this. Bourjois claims this adds up to 10x more volume to your lashes. A bit of an overstatement in my opinion. It did make my lashes look volumised but 10x is a bit much really. It didn't make them look clumpy and it was buildable with a few coats. Bourjois also state that it will last for 16 hours. Now I don't know if this is true or not as i've never worn mascara for 16 hours without taking it off at some point in that time. Don't know why you would need to wear it for that long either to be honest, but each to their own I guess. It stayed on all day for the 9 hours or so that I was wearing it.
 
This is the first mascara i've ever tried from Bourjois, i'm a Maybelline girl at heart when it comes to mascaras, but I am enjoying using this. I suppose Bourjois are least well known for their eye products, i'd say their speciality are their face products, but having tried this mascara I will take more of an interest in their other mascaras next time i'm in Boots or Superdrug.
